Mangrove Conservation

First place where I visited is Mangrove Conservation. I met with a farmer of mangrove trees in there. We talked about mangrove and recent condition in Pramuka Island. Mangrove trees are very important to prevent sea waves to this island since there are many native people live in here.

Thousand Islands (Pramuka Island and all around) #Day1


Yeah, travelling time! :) On December 28 - 29, 2013, I went to Pramuka Island by ship from Muara Angke Harbor. Pramuka Island is one of the islands in Thousand Islands. It is the first stop of the ship that I took from Muara Angke. Before going to there, I rent all stuffs through Mr. Ismail (08176405654) including boat for hoping islands (300k/boat), snorkeling devices (25k/person), and also homestay (350k/home). The first things I did in there was hoping islands :) Lol. I did hoping islands to Semak Daun Island and Water Island.

Semak Daun Island
Semak Daun Island had really beautiful beach. I found fishes along the beach. That was awesome! :) Semak Daun Island is a small island. There is a guard in this island, then you have to pay at least 20k to him for the security and cleaning service fee. In this island, you can find a canteen. Water Island
Water Island is just water which is located between two very long islands. As some people said, the picture that I took looks like scenery in Maldives. But, I don't know exactly. In Water Island, we can't visit the islands because it belongs to someone (on the other words : private island) and we are not allowed to go to there without special permission.
